1st and foremost....WHAT ARE STOPS/DOUBLE STOPS?!? 2nd. are there any lessons on this on GMC 3rd. if not tell me how to do it please Double stops are at their simplest 2 notes played together, often with one of the notes bent - simple huh? A very common one to do is to fret the high E string with your pinky, fret the b strning with your ring finger on the same fret, and then bend your ring finger up a whole tone.
